CM600 - Admin Page Not Responding
The administrative page at 192.168.100.1 of my CM600 cable modem has mysteriously stopped responding. I've tried several browsers and there's simply no response anymore -- no login request, nothing....
- Jan 15, 2017
As a follow-up -- a hard reset solved the problem. Thanks to all for the advice.
